  • Publication number: 20250284760
    Abstract: Most chemical processes are nonlinear in nature and are time-varying in nature. Some processes are fast changing and some are slow changing in nature. As the operating conditions change, it is important that the model and its parameters be updated to realize the benefits of model-based control. Systems and methods are provided for updating a model, the method including detecting a change in an output of the model responsive to providing a set of inputs to the model, in response to detecting the change in the output, triggering a new model detection flag using a blockwise recursive partial least squares (RPLS) algorithm. The model is further strengthened by using a delayed just-in-time update.
